Connect the opener to the garage door bracket. In lots of cases, there will be 2 pieces to be utilized to hook the door to the opener, allowing some versatility in the connection, given that the range between the door and the opener assembly is variable. Attach the security cable to the trolley.
It should be adapted to be about 6 feet so that any adult can reach it. Place a bulb in the opener socket, if you have one. In the user’s manual or inside the opener compartment, the appropriate voltage for the bulb must be suggested, but it is practical to purchase one that is resistant to endure vibrations.
Lots of garage door openers utilize the light to show that they are making shows modifications. Be sure to install your opener bulb to ensure you can set the door properly. Install the security sensors consisted of with the garage door opener. You will have to run 2 little wires through the bottom of each side of the door, to which the sensors will connect at no greater than 6 inches above the ground.
Install the wall-activation button about 5 feet from the ground, so that children can not reach it. Position it in a spot where the person utilizing it can see the garage door. Install and program any optional devices included, such as the keypad to open the door from outside or remote openers.
Look for the information in the opener producer’s guidelines. Evaluate the garage door to ensure the opener is working appropriately and follow the manual guidelines to adjust the opening and closing limitations. If the door and opener move efficiently, all parts are correctly secured and there are no obstructions that block the movement of the door or opener, everything is proper.
If you see that there is damage in any part of the opener, do not use it up until it has actually been repaired by the qualified technical service. Never ever utilize the door if the security system does not work properly. When a month, check that the security reversing system and the sensing units work and adjust whatever is needed.
Constantly offer top priority to the setup manual consisted of with your opener. It is composed for the specific opener, while these guidelines are more general. Strengthen light fiberglass or metal doors before installing an opener to prevent damage to the door and make sure that the safety reversing system works correctly. If possible, use manual disconnection only when the garage door is completely closed.
Always detach the electrical power of the opener when you are inspecting the system or working near the chain/belt or other moving parts. Never change or eliminate the springs, cables or pulley-blocks from the garage door. Doors with torsion springs must just be checked by a certified garage door service professional.
Keep the transmitter in a place unattainable to them. Do not use rings, watches or big clothing while setting up or preserving the garage door or opener. They could get captured with a moving part and trigger you an injury or harm an item.

Many of today’s newer houses have an electric garage door opener to supply simple access, safety and security. There are numerous drive options availablechain, screw, belt, direct and jackshaft. The most common design is installed on the garage ceiling, and links to the within of the door. If you’re a convenient DIYer, you may have the ability to tackle this job yourself with help from this detailed installation guide.
While you may be familiar with other house improvement jobs, without being a setup specialist, you may harm the opener, or worse yet, get injured. Before you pull out your tools, you must make certain your garage door is operating appropriately. Open and close the door and look for broken or missing rollers, loose cable televisions, loud operation of the torsion springs, and if the door is lubricated and balanced.
Remove all ropes, cords and locks so you won’t get tangled in them or inadvertently engage them during the setup. If you’re ready to find out how to install a brand name brand-new garage door opener, follow the actions listed below. You’ll require an electric outlet near the opener, clamps, a measuring tape, a cordless drill and bits, and numerous wrenches.
Move the trolley over the rail. Connect the rail to the motor. Location the sheave at the end of the rail. Move the belt or chain from completion of the rail; slip it around the pulley-block, then feed it around the motor end. Connect the belt or chain end to the trolley/carriage.
